| As the core component of the relay protection of the traction power supply system,the relay protection device needs to complete a large number of complete and effective tests to ensure its reliability before being put into use.However,the current relay protection device testing is mainly done manually,this test method has many shortcomings such as large workload,low test efficiency,and difficulty in guaranteeing test consistency.Therefore,based on the current relay protection tester technology,this paper designs an automatic test system for the traction power supply system,and develops the corresponding automatic test software to realize the automatic test function that can replace the manual.First,this article analyzes the testing process and shortcomings of the traditional manual testing method,and then puts forward the basic requirements of automatic testing,and through the analysis of the protection function and related technical conditions of the relay protection device of the traction power supply system,the specific requirements of the test functions in the automatic test system of relay protection is proposed and it should be able to meet the testing of multiple types of protection such as overcurrent,loss of voltage,differential,and alarm.In addition,a detailed requirement analysis was made for the communication function,human-computer interaction and system performance in the automatic test system,which can provide reference for the design and implementation of the test system.Secondly,the overall design of the relay protection automatic test system is carried out,focusing on the analysis of the hardware composition and software architecture of the system.Aiming at the realization process of the test function,the function of the basic module and the reference relationship of the database in the system are analyzed,and the expansion of the system is designed based on the database.Aiming at the communication difficulties in the test system,this paper focuses on the analysis of the structure,format and transmission mechanism of the IEC60870-5-104 protocol message,and it provides a theoretical basis for realizing the functions of automatic reading and writing of the setting value of the protection device and automatic switching on and off of the protection function.Then,according to the design rules of the basic module,the development technology and implementation process of the over or under module,the action time module,and the differential module are analyzed with emphasis.For implement a communication function,according to the protocol developed IEC60870-5-104 value corresponding module,and analyzes and processes the specific communication setting modification process.For the test of alarm protection,the specific test method and test process are analyzed.Aiming at the realization of automatic test,taking the test development of specific protection function as an example,the realization of the test function is analyzed and the automatic test process of the complete protection device function is introduced.Finally,part of the interface and functions of the automatic test software are introduced,and a corresponding test environment is built according to the test requirements of a specific protection device.By running the automatic test program written,the test is completed and the corresponding test report is generated.By comparing the results of automatic test and manual test,it is pointed out that the relay protection automatic test system designed in this paper can improve the test efficiency and test quality,which has achieved the expected effect,and has high practicability and economy. |
